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77459932470 62 58395147 5873998020 244
80993 75701193 95
80993 75701193 95
145 617 16 7675
All about undefined
Interested in learning more?
80993 75701193 95
145 617 16 7675
See more
592707151 14 50721
7413881 0815900 788228 41680131
See more
06 33
85900237 5762 03243 35
See more